
Works by Helen Taylor
This exhibition of charcoal and pencil, Works by Helen Taylor passed a skilled and critical eye over country regions from Pemberton in the south to the Eastern Goldfields, and from Cue to Geraldton in the north of Western Australia. The exhibition provided an opportunity to see an approach to landscape which challenged both the 'picturesque’ tradition and the typical representation of human activity, including commonly celebrated themes of male struggle on the land. While the framed works were appreciated conventionally as the artist's response to the landscapes, the large installation drawings created a particularly apt sense in the viewer of being confronted with an experience similar to that had by the artist in the landscape itself.
